Kung Fu Tea is a well-known brand in the world of bubble tea and they have a strong commitment to creating visually striking and engaging content to convey their brand. Their project pipeline includes a thorough process of gathering the best content to represent their brand, which includes custom graphic design and illustration.
The company’s approach to creating content is to start with concept explorations, which are presented in the form of mood boards, related inspiration and sketches. This allows the team to explore various ideas and concepts before narrowing down the final design. The end result is a polished, high-quality piece of content that perfectly represents the Kung Fu Tea brand. This approach has proven to be successful for the company and has helped them to stand out in a crowded marketplace.
